All of the 1, 2 and 3 bedroom lodges have a superb location on the park, high on the hilltop, many with far-reaching coastal and countryside views. With your own private decking area you can enjoy al fresco dining and marvel at the night sky. Many of the lodges are available all year round.
The lodges are located close to the facilities on the park, with Highlands End Leisure Club, Martin’s Bar & Restaurant and the Park Shop all within a couple of minutes walking distance. There are 2 and 3 bedroom lodges with incredible views over miles of countryside and Jurassic Coast, from West Bay right across Lyme Bay to Portland Bill. Select lodges are dog friendly, with a maximum of 2 welcome (charges apply). There are also 1 bedroom lodges with partial views, perfect for couples and walkers to enjoy a romantic or relaxing break.
As you arrive at your holiday lodge, you will love the spacious living area, luxury touches and modern design. It really is a place to feel at home and enjoy some time out with loved ones. The layout and space provides a haven for relaxation.
Each lodge is totally unique in its style and feel, nicely complimenting the location and far-reaching coastal views. You will find a fully-fitted kitchen, including a dishwasher, hob, oven, fridge/freezer and all the cooking equipment, crockery and cutlery you will need. Linen and bedding are included and made up for your arrival; everything you need to start enjoying your holiday the minute you arrive. Each lodge features a double bedroom with an en-suite then any further bedrooms are twins with a family shower room. There is allocated parking right next to your lodge and further parking for guests in the Leisure Club car park. There are allocated dog friendly lodges and there is an enclosed 3.5 acre dog exercising meadow and doggy shower on the park.

Guests at all West Dorset Leisure Holiday’s parks are welcome to use the facilities at Highlands End Holiday Park, which includes Highlands End Leisure Club with swimming pool, sauna and steam room, pitch ‘n’ putt course, children’s soft play, nature trail and the dog friendly Martin’s Bar & Restaurant with sunday carvery, live sport, events, Costa Coffee and more. Please note charges apply for many of these facilities. Complimentary use of Highlands End Leisure Club is provided for guests staying in Lodge Holiday Homes.
